How Our Commercial Water Extraction Process Works

Our team’s process for commercial water extraction is designed to get your property back to normal as quickly as possible. We understand that every minute counts when dealing with water damage, which is why we use the latest equipment to extract water quickly and efficiently. Our team will work closely with you to develop a customized plan to meet your specific needs and get your business back up and running in no time.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ll send a team of experts to assess the damage and develop a customized plan to meet your specific needs.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ify the source of the leak.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action to take and ensuring that the job is done right the first time.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our team will use specialized equipment to extract water from your property, including wet/dry vacuums, submersible pumps, and more. We’ll work tirelessly to remove as much water as possible to prevent further damage and reduce drying time.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your property. This step is crucial in preventing mold and mildew growth and ensuring that your property is safe and healthy.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Our team will use specialized cleaning solutions to remove any remaining moisture and sanitize your property. This step is crucial in preventing the growth of mold and mildew and ensuring that your property is safe and healthy.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Once the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, our team will work with you to develop a plan to restore and reconstruct your property. This may include repairing or replacing damaged materials, such as drywall, flooring, and more.

Warning Signs You Need Commercial Water Extraction

Beware of these warning signs that show you need commercial water extraction: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ong musty odors can be a sign of hidden moisture and mold growth.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your property, it’s time to call our team.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s time to call our team.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ains on wal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any water stains, it’s time to call our team.

Discoloration or Warping of Walls or Ceilings

Discoloration or warping of wal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your walls or ceilings, it’s time to call our team.

Unexplained Leaks or Water Damage

Unexplained leaks or water damage can be a sign of a larger issue. If you notice any water damage or leaks, it’s time to call our team.

Increased Humidity or Moisture Levels

Increased humidity or moisture levels can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your property’s humidity or moisture levels, it’s time to call our team.

Commercial Water Extraction Cost in Annandale, VA

The cost of commercial water extraction in Annandale, VA can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team will work closely with you to develop a customized plan and provide a detailed estimate of the costs involved.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of commercial water extraction: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Restoration and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and materials needed
Equipment Rental $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Travel and Labor Costs $500 – $2,000 Distance to job site, size of affected area, and labor needed

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ges and the actual cost of commercial water extraction may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will work closely with you to develop a customized plan and provide a detailed estimate of the costs involved.
